  1. meson, xen: fix condition for enabling the Xen accelerator

    A misspelled condition in xen_native.h is hiding a bug in the enablement of
    Xen for qemu-system-aarch64.  The bug becomes apparent when building for
    Xen 4.18.
    
    While the i386 emulator provides the xenpv machine type for multiple architectures,
    and therefore can be compiled with Xen enabled even when the host is Arm, the
    opposite is not true: qemu-system-aarch64 can only be compiled with Xen support
    enabled when the host is Arm.
    
    Expand the computation of accelerator_targets['CONFIG_XEN'] similar to what is
    already there for KVM.

  4. block: Fix AioContext locking in qmp_block_resize()

    The AioContext must be unlocked before calling blk_co_unref(), because
    it takes the AioContext lock internally in blk_unref_bh(), which is
    scheduled in the main thread. If we don't unlock, the AioContext is
    locked twice and nested event loops such as in bdrv_graph_wrlock() will
    deadlock.

  6. target/i386: Fix 32-bit wrapping of pc/eip computation

    In 32-bit mode, pc = eip + cs_base is also 32-bit, and must wrap.
    Failure to do so results in incorrect memory exceptions to the guest.
    Before 732d548, this was implicitly done via truncation to
    target_ulong but only in qemu-system-i386, not qemu-system-x86_64.
    
    To fix this, we must add conditional zero-extensions.
    Since we have to test for 32 vs 64-bit anyway, note that cs_base
    is always zero in 64-bit mode.
